Composition and Metallurgical Characteristics

Ang 5454 aluminium alloy belongs to the 5000 serye ng mga, which means it primarily contains magnesium as its main alloying element. Its typical composition includes:

Elemento Porsyento (%) Function
Magnesium (Mg) 3.2 – 3.8 Imparts strength, paglaban sa kaagnasan
Mga mangganeso (Mn) 0.10 – 0.50 Improves strength and workability
Silicon (Si Si) ≤ 0.40 Enhances corrosion resistance, reduces cracking
Bakal na Bakal (Fe) ≤ 0.40 Adds to strength, can be controlled for surface finish
Ang iba naman Trace elements Minor impurities, natural in the alloy

Ang H112 temper designation indicates that the alloy has been strain-hardened to achieve a specific mechanical strength without further heat treatment.

This process enhances the sheet’s rigidity, making it suitable for demanding structural applications.

Mga Katangian ng Mekanikal

Ang 5454 H112 aluminium alloy sheet showcases impressive mechanical strength combined with excellent electrical conductivity and formability. Key properties include:

Mekanikal na Ari arian Karaniwang Halaga Remarks
Lakas ng Paghatak 220 – 280 MPa Ensures durability and load-bearing capacity
Yield Lakas (0.2%) 155 – 195 MPa Structural reliability under stress
Pagpapahaba sa Break ≥ 12% Good formability for shaping and fabrication
Ang katigasan ng ulo Tinatayang 60 HB Surface durability and resistance

These properties enable the 6mm aluminium alloy sheet 5454 H112 to withstand various environmental and mechanical stresses effectively.

Fabrication Techniques

The alloy supports various manufacturing methods, kasama na ang:

  • Pagputol: Using laser, plasma, or waterjet cutting for precise shaping.
  • Pagbaluktot: Achievable with appropriate tooling without cracking or distortion.
  • Welding: Gas tungsten arc welding (GTAW) and metal inert gas (MIG) welding provide reliable joints.
  • Surface Finishing: Polishing, powder coating, or anodizing enhances appearance and corrosion resistance.

Essential Welding Tips

  • Use filler wire that matches the alloy to preserve properties.
  • Maintain appropriate heat input to avoid warping.
  • Clean surfaces thoroughly before welding to prevent defects.

Implementing these practices ensures strength, tibay ng katawan, at aesthetic appeal.

Quality Standards and Certification

Manufacturers should adhere to international standards like ASTM B209, EN 485, at ISO 6361 for quality assurance.

Certifying compliance ensures the sheet meets structural safety and durability expectations.

Maintenance and Longevity Considerations

The 6mm aluminium alloy sheet 5454 H112 offers long-term performance with proper care. Here are maintenance tips to maximize its lifespan:

Regular Cleaning

Use mild detergents and water to clean surface dirt and pollutants. Avoid harsh chemicals that could damage the oxide layer.

Mga Protective Coating

Applying protective paint or anodized layers offers an extra shield against environmental corrosion, especially in marine or industrial settings.

Inspection and Repairs

Routine inspections help identify surface defects like scratches or corrosion early. Prompt repairs preserve structural integrity.

Imbakan

Store sheets in dry, covered environments, stacked flat to prevent warping or surface damage.
